Construction Pre-Apprenticeship


This pre-apprenticeship training prepares you for an apprenticeship with a construction trade union.

Overview

This full-time program gives hands-on training in construction trades like carpentry and electrical. It also teaches math skills, an overview of the industry, and professionalism and job readiness. After you complete the program, you will be given special consideration for when interviews open for apprenticeships in construction unions. There are providers who offer tailored trainings:

  • Non-Traditional Employment for Women - Serves women, transgender, and non-binary people
  • Construction Skills - Serves minorities from all five boroughs
  • Pathways to Apprenticeship - Serves re-entry, justice-involved, and low-income people.



Eligibility

In order to be eligible, program candidates must:

  • Be at least 18 years old
  • Be a New York City resident
  • Be authorized to work in the United States
  • Have a High School Diploma or equivalency (GED/HSED)
  • Have eighth-grade reading and math comprehension or above
  • Be interested in a career in the construction trades
  • Be willing to commit to a multi-year paid apprenticeship program with a union (after the pre-apprenticeship)
  • Be able to attend unpaid training during the day Monday through Friday (limited night class options)



FAQ

What is the schedule?

Four to seven weeks of full-time training during the day, Monday through Friday.
